Holidaymakers cut vacations short, return home for referendum [ Domestic ]
Turkish voters have decided to return to their places of residence from summer vacations and the Eid al-Fitr holiday -- a three-day religious holiday that marks the end of the month of Ramadan -- earlier than in past years in order to vote in the upcoming public referendum on the constitutional amendment package. Others have cancelled plans to visit their loved ones in far-away cities during Eid in order not to miss the referendum.
